- [ ] Step 7: Archive cold storage buckets (Glacierline tier). Confirm both ceremony witnesses are present, verify bucket manifests match the Oxbow ledger, then seal the archive key shares. Plugin authors may observe but not handle shares. Once sealed, the archive index itself is encrypted and can only be reopened with the passphrase below.

vault phrase of badup-hahig = tamael-aldael-kelmir-istael-fenok-istwyn-tamius-jorath-oliion

Runbook — ShrinkRay batch resize CLI (security review). ShrinkRay runs unprivileged, reads only from the configured input root, and writes to a tmpfs staging area before atomic move. No network access at runtime; codec plugins are loaded from a read-only signed bundle. Verify: seccomp profile active, input root mount is noexec, and plugin bundle signature validates against the Hollis release key. All invocations log to the local audit sink. The approved build for this review cycle is identified by the token below.

build token for kagaf-hahof: htk14_9d3d4d26d7d8de

So the Veltro upstream API falls over a few times a month, and our circuit breaker in Gatehouse handles it. If you see the breaker stuck open, don't just force-close it — check Veltro's status page analog in our Murkwatch dashboard first, then half-open manually and watch error rates. Before touching anything, confirm you're on the right Gatehouse build using the token below.

pipeline stamp: htk9_ce63042d9

# Formula Sandbox — Data Stores

User-supplied formulas in Tallowgrid run inside the Hexbox sandbox with no filesystem or network access. Evaluation results and per-formula quotas persist in the `sandbox_meta` store; the sandbox itself never touches it directly — only the supervisor does. Release managers: before cutting a release, confirm that quota rows for the new formula version exist, otherwise every evaluation falls back to the zero-quota path and fails closed. The supervisor reaches the metadata store using the connection string below.

warehouse DSN: mssql://rusdor_svc:0FSWCn9@db-951a.paliqforge.local:5432/ulawyn